Book Description
Play to Win offers nonprofit leaders the help they need to develop their organization?s unique competitive advantages and to use the power of competitive strategies to build their organization?s capacity for advancing its mission. This book offers a clear description of competition and discusses its practical, ethical, and political ramifications within the nonprofit sector. It demonstrates how, by being a more effective competitor, a nonprofit can enhance its chances for both programmatic and financial success. Play to Win is filled with practical tools for assessing a nonprofit?s position in the marketplace and developing winning competitive strategies.
